One of the main advantages of using wooden crates for shipping overseas is their durability. Wooden crates are much sturdier than other types of packaging, such as cardboard boxes or plastic containers. This means that they are less likely to break or become damaged during transit, ensuring that your items arrive at their destination in perfect condition. Wooden crates are also less likely to collapse under pressure, making them a reliable choice for shipping heavy or bulky items.
Another benefit of using wooden crates for shipping overseas is their versatility. Wooden crates can be easily customized to fit the specific dimensions of your items, providing a snug and secure fit that helps to prevent any movement during transit. This is particularly important for fragile items, as it reduces the risk of damage caused by shifting or jostling during shipping. Additionally, wooden crates can be easily stacked on top of one another, maximizing space in shipping containers and allowing you to transport more goods in a single shipment.
Wooden crates are also a more sustainable option compared to other types of packaging. Unlike plastic containers, which can take hundreds of years to decompose, wooden crates are biodegradable and can be easily recycled or repurposed after use. This makes them a more environmentally friendly choice for businesses looking to reduce their carbon footprint and minimize waste.
